Immunohistochemical expression of Hsp60 correlates with tumor progression and hormone resistance in prostate cancer.

机构信息

Instituto de Biomedicina de Sevilla (IBiS), Hospital Universitario Virgen del Rocío/CSIC/Universidad de Sevilla, Seville, Spain.

出版信息

Urology. 2010 Oct;76(4):1017.e1-6. doi: 10.1016/j.urology.2010.05.045. Epub 2010 Aug 12.

DOI:10.1016/j.urology.2010.05.045
PMID:20708221
Abstract

OBJECTIVES

To investigate the expression of Hsp60 protein in prostate cancer biopsy samples, and its association with prognostic clinical parameters and hormone resistance and survival. Molecular chaperones are involved in protein folding, protein degradation, and protein trafficking among subcellular compartments.

METHODS

We selected 107 patients with localized and locally advanced prostate cancer at our hospital from 1999 through 2004. We performed an analysis by western blot and immunohistochemistry on paraffin-embedded tissue sections. Clinical data were used to determine associations between immunohistochemical expression of Hsp60 and tumor behavior.

RESULTS

The expression level of Hsp60 was significantly increased in tumors with high Gleason score (P < .001). Hsp60 expression was also significantly associated with initial serum PSA levels (P < .01) and with the presence of lymph node metastasis (P < .003). In 50 locally advanced cancers treated by androgen ablation we found an association between high Hsp60-expressing tumors and an early onset of hormone refractory disease (P < .02) and reduced cancer-specific survival (P < .05).

CONCLUSIONS

Hsp60 protein is overexpressed in poorly differentiated prostate cancers. Hsp60 expression is strongly associated with prognostic clinical parameters, such as Gleason score, initial serum PSA levels, and lymph node metastasis and with the onset of hormone-refractory disease and reduced cancer-specific survival. Identification of such markers could be of relevance in the clinical management of prostate cancer.

摘要

目的

研究热休克蛋白 60(Hsp60)在前列腺癌活检组织中的表达,及其与预后临床参数、激素抵抗和生存的关系。分子伴侣参与蛋白质折叠、蛋白质降解和亚细胞区室之间的蛋白质运输。

方法

我们选择了 1999 年至 2004 年在我院就诊的 107 例局限性和局部进展性前列腺癌患者。我们对石蜡包埋组织切片进行了 Western blot 和免疫组织化学分析。临床数据用于确定 Hsp60 免疫组织化学表达与肿瘤行为之间的关系。

结果

Hsp60 的表达水平在高 Gleason 评分的肿瘤中显著增加(P<0.001)。Hsp60 的表达也与初始血清前列腺特异性抗原(PSA)水平(P<0.01)和淋巴结转移的存在(P<0.003)显著相关。在 50 例接受雄激素剥夺治疗的局部进展性癌症中,我们发现高 Hsp60 表达肿瘤与激素抵抗性疾病的早期发生(P<0.02)和癌症特异性生存时间降低(P<0.05)之间存在关联。

结论

Hsp60 蛋白在分化不良的前列腺癌中过度表达。Hsp60 的表达与预后临床参数密切相关,如 Gleason 评分、初始血清 PSA 水平和淋巴结转移,以及激素抵抗性疾病的发生和癌症特异性生存时间的降低。鉴定这些标志物可能对前列腺癌的临床管理具有重要意义。
